Output 00d612e65be4ea589c6c10aee9c8358aaebe5f04cdb83ed900412d5cbc3322b2:3

value
149342979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 068b622a70e0d9bed89407dc8c7d8f3233b16e1c OP_EQUAL
address
M8VmG7YwUHCYaKH7Rav9hRbACsfnpJs33u
transaction
00d612e65be4ea589c6c10aee9c8358aaebe5f04cdb83ed900412d5cbc3322b2
spent
true